> While doing this noticed the LA_SYMB_NOPLTEXIT omission for
> the '-s syms' case; not knowing if that was intentional i did
> not change that.
yea, I probably overlooked that.. however I checked glibc source and once
you return LA_SYMB_NOPLTENTER, pltexit is never called anyway.. but
I added it just in case glibc will fix this in the future.. thanks for noticing
